About the role

The Clinical Supervisor - Therapy is responsible for overseeing patient care and clinical personnel. This is a hybrid role combining fieldwork and office-based responsibilities.

Responsibilities

  • In the field: Oversee clinicians providing care and treatment to patients in their place of residence, including performance evaluations and hiring.
  • Daily patient activities: Handle incoming calls, follow up as necessary, coordinate training and educational programs, assess staff learning needs, perform administrative call duties, and serve as a role model and resource for staff.
  • First point of contact: Assist in patient care escalations and coordinate Case Conferences with the clinical team to discuss patients' progress and revise care plans.
  • Review and evaluate cases: Review services provided by clinicians, conferences, record reviews, discuss and verify impressions, instruct and guide clinicians, and be available during operating hours to assist clinicians as appropriate.
  • Assist in establishing therapeutic goals: Assist clinicians in setting priorities and developing a plan of care.

Requirements

  • Two years management or supervisory experience in a rehabilitation therapy department or program.
  • Home Health Experience is highly preferred.
  • Possesses a degree from a baccalaureate or masters program in applicable discipline approved by an accredited organization.
  • Current CA Occupational Therapist license.
  • Current Basic Life Support (BLS) certification.
  • Valid CA Drivers License with acceptable driving record.
